postgresql

如何监控和优化PostgreSQL集群的性能

小樊
83
2024-08-26 14:42:32
栏目: 云计算

监控和优化PostgreSQL集群的性能是非常重要的,以下是一些方法:

  1. 使用性能监控工具:可以使用像pg_stat_statements、pg_stat_activity等内建的性能监控工具来监控数据库的性能表现。也可以使用第三方性能监控工具如pgBadger、pgAdmin等。

  2. 优化查询语句:优化查询语句是提升性能的重要一步。可以使用EXPLAIN命令来查看查询计划,从而优化查询语句的性能。

  3. 索引优化:合理使用索引可以提升查询性能。对于频繁查询的字段,可以添加索引来提升查询速度。

  4. 配置参数优化:PostgreSQL有很多配置参数,可以根据实际情况进行调整以提升性能。比如调整shared_buffers、work_mem等参数。

  5. 定期清理和优化数据:定期清理无用数据、优化表结构、重新构建索引等操作可以提升数据库性能。

  6. 负载均衡和集群部署:可以考虑使用负载均衡器、集群部署等方式来提升数据库性能和可用性。

  7. 持续监控和调整:持续监控数据库性能,及时发现问题并进行调整,可以最大程度地提升数据库性能。

0
看了该问题的人还看了